3d清理垃圾代码_大家看看这段代码为什么执行后是垃圾值

原问题:大家看看这段代码为什么执行后是垃圾值
分类:编程开发 > 最后更新时间:【2016-12-16 01:36:04】
问题补充:

#include <stdio.h>#include <stdlib.h>int main(void){int a;int b=a*365; printf("输入你的年龄:");scanf("%d",&a);printf("%d\n",b);return 0;}

最佳答案

在你的程序中

int b=a*365; //这里a没有赋初始,它是个随机数

你声明时用

int a,b;

然后将

b=a*365;

写在

scanf("%d",&a);

后面就可以了(注意程序的执行顺序)

最佳答案由网友  whoami1978  提供
公告: 为响应国家净网行动,部分内容已经删除,感谢网友理解。
6

分享到:

其他回答

暂无其它回答!

    推荐